Lynn is the very proud mother of a beautiful daughter, a wife, and an educator! Her daughter’s favorite thing she has learned from her mother is that astronauts really do wear diapers in Space!!!

She was born and raised in Columbia, Missouri, and attended the University of Missouri, graduating with a Bachelor’s degree in Biology in 2000. During her Mizzou S.C.U.B.A. Theory Science class, she was presented with an opportunity to teach Marine Science in the Florida Keys at Seacamp. After three years of Keys living, Lynn decided to return to school at the University of Florida, graduating with her Master’s in Secondary Science Education in 2005. In 2005, Lynn landed her first teaching job in Brevard at a Montessori School and continued teaching science at various levels in both private and public Brevard County Schools. During the summers Lynn worked at the Brevard Zoo as an Earth Explorer camp counselor and with Brevard Schools developing scope and sequence science curriculum and served on the textbook adoption committee. In 2010, Lynn was awarded the Exemplary Science Teacher of Brevard County and was sent to Space Camp for Educators in Huntsville, Alabama. Her passion for teaching both students and teachers, her experiences on the Space Coast, and Space Camp ultimately led to her job with NASA’s Exploration Station. Lynn has worked 12 years as an Education Specialist at NASA’s Kennedy Space Center first at the Exploration Station operated by the Astronauts Memorial Foundation and currently an Education Specialist/Coordinator II with AETOS/GoH, NASA Next Generation STEM Program.
